Output 66dbccbacb8da635b864671dedb7fd045afedaa98902a21d36b0b33c035e73e7:1

value
32386
script pubkey
OP_0 OP_PUSHBYTES_20 bf5202ab43ca4881105fbf20470b850256a44910
address
bc1qhafq926refygzyzlhusywzu9qft2gjgsc4g35r
transaction
66dbccbacb8da635b864671dedb7fd045afedaa98902a21d36b0b33c035e73e7
spent
true